Retail has always been a driving force for the Roman city. Today the retail market is modern and dynamic, both in the centre and the suburbs of the city.

Codata identified 82 sites in the province of Rome. Commercial areas, shopping centres and shopping streets represent more than 4,500 shops in total.

In Rome, Codata identified 8 shopping streets linked to only 2 shopping centres as the layout of the old centre doesn't favour the creation of large commercial areas.

The main commercial axes in the centre of Rome are Via del Corso for mass-market retailers, Via Frattina and Via Dei Condotti for upmarket retailers and the shopping centre Stazione Termini.

In the suburbs, we registered 32 commercial areas to which many shopping centres are linked. For instance, the cluster Roma: Via delle Vigne Nuove (Auchan) with the shopping centre Porta di Roma (194 shops including OVS, Coin and Media World) and the cluster Roma: Via dell'Oceano Pacifico (Ipercoop) linked to the region’s largest shopping centre, Euroma Due (222 shops including Elena Mirò, Conbipel and Tezenis). There are also the shopping centres Leonardo (172 shops), Roma Est (211 shops) and La Romanina (80 shops).
